These pelvic flooring muscle workouts were named after Dr. Arnold Kegel, who explained them in the 1940s to aid patients strengthen their pelvic floor muscle mass to deal with urinary incontinence. At your six-week postpartum visit, your carrier will certainly analyze your pelvic flooring by examining the stamina of your Kegel exercise, which is the squeezing of your pelvic flooring muscle mass. If we figure out that your Kegel is weak, we may recommend a pelvic floor workout routine as component of your daily regimen. The bright side is, there is therapy for postpartum urinary incontinence, and the majority of females locate their signs enhance over the course of 6-12 months.

Advise incontinence (necessity urinary incontinence) is one more usual type of postpartum urinary system incontinence and is specified by the loss of urine following an unexpected impulse to pee. Ladies that had bladder leak during pregnancy are additionally most likely to experience urinary system incontinence after distribution.
